在当今数字化时代,越来越多用户依赖虚拟私人网络(VPN)来保护隐私、访问境外内容或绕过地域限制,Shadowsocks(简称 SS)作为一款轻量级、高效率的代理工具,因其开源特性、低延迟和良好的兼容性广受欢迎,许多用户反映使用 SS 时速度缓慢,尤其在高峰时段或跨境传输中表现不佳,本文将深入剖析 SS VPN 速度慢的原因,并提供一套系统性的优化方案,帮助你显著提升连接速度与稳定性。
我们要理解 SS 的工作原理,Shadowsocks 是一种基于 SOCKS5 协议的加密代理工具,它通过本地客户端与远程服务器建立加密隧道,实现流量转发,其性能瓶颈通常出现在以下几个环节:
- 服务器带宽与地理位置:如果服务器带宽不足或距离你太远,数据包传输延迟高,自然影响速度。
- 加密算法选择不当:默认的 AES-256-CFB 算法虽然安全,但对 CPU 资源消耗较大,尤其在低端设备上容易拖慢整体性能。
- 网络环境波动:家庭宽带质量差、ISP 限速、防火墙干扰等都会导致连接不稳定。
- 客户端配置不合理:如未启用 TCP 快速打开(TCP Fast Open)、未优化线程数或未设置合理的超时时间。
针对以上问题,我们可以采取以下优化策略:
第一步:选择优质服务器
优先选择位于你所在区域附近、带宽充足(建议 ≥ 100Mbps)的服务器,如果你在中国大陆,可以选择香港、新加坡或日本的节点;若在美国,则可考虑美国西海岸的服务器,可以使用 ping 和 traceroute 工具测试延迟,目标是 RTT(往返延迟)低于 50ms。
第二步:调整加密方式
推荐使用更高效的加密算法,如 Chacha20-Poly1305 或 AES-128-GCM,这些算法在现代 CPU 上运行更快,且支持硬件加速(如 Intel AES-NI),可在客户端设置中修改加密方式,避免使用过旧的 CBC 模式。
第三步:优化 TCP 参数
在 Linux 或 macOS 系统中,可通过修改内核参数提升 TCP 性能:
net.core.rmem_max = 16777216 net.core.wmem_max = 16777216 net.ipv4.tcp_rmem = 4096 87380 16777216 net.ipv4.tcp_wmem = 4096 65536 16777216
开启 TCP Fast Open(TFO)可减少握手延迟,适用于高并发场景。
第四步:使用多线程或分片传输
部分高级 SS 客户端(如 v2rayN、Clash for Windows)支持多路复用(Multiplexing),即多个请求共用一个连接,减少连接开销,开启 UDP 转发(若服务端支持)可提升视频流媒体或游戏类应用的流畅度。
第五步:定期维护与监控
建议每月检查服务器负载和日志,及时更换频繁掉线或响应慢的节点,可用 speedtest-cli 测试实际带宽,并对比不同时间段的速度变化,找出最稳定的时段使用。
最后提醒:虽然优化能显著提升 SS 速度,但请务必遵守当地法律法规,合理合法使用网络服务,如果你发现某节点始终卡顿,不要盲目切换,而是先排查是否为 ISP 干预(如深度包检测 DDoS),必要时联系服务商更换线路。
通过上述方法,大多数用户可将 SS 速度提升 30%~70%,甚至达到接近直连的体验,优化是一个持续过程,结合自身网络环境不断调试,才能获得最佳效果。

半仙加速器-海外加速器 | VPN加速器 | VPN翻墙加速器 | VPN梯子 | VPN外网加速






